What you should know about Toa
TOA’s corporate creed is, “We sell Sound, not Just Equipment”.
TOA is the first supplier in South Africa approved by a fully accredited testing body.
TOA Electronics Europe GMBH is responsible for the sales and distribution of TOA products throughout mainland Europe and the Middle East.
The TOA Corporation was founded in 1934 in Kobe, Japan, and has had a leading effect upon the development of the acoustic and communication technology.
As part of a major building and mechanical revamp, various South African prisons have been provided with a TOA VS-900 intercom system and public address system. The system allows prison officials to communicate with more than 120 substations positioned in cells, courtyards and passages. Ideal for applications with multiple sub stations calling in to one or more master stations, the VS-900 has a wide range of standard and software programmable features, including comprehensive Call-Forwarding to allow system operators freedom of movement and most importantly, to ensure that no calls go unanswered. Other features include telephone system integration, paging and external source distribution, event logging, and recording outputs. The VS-900 scalable architecture allows the most cost effective configuration for each application with easy expansion as the size of the facility grows. Sub-stations include Economy, Indoor, Outdoor, and Panic models, each with heavy-duty plate, call switch and optional LED/relay control. The TOA VX-2000 Integrated Voice Evacuation System (covered by a 5 Year Warranty), originally built to comply with EN60849:2005 (adopted by SA as SANS60849) is ideal for this type of application where there are multiple zones and each floor is to be treated as an independent zone which is capable of having its own dedicated microphone for the Fire Marshall controlling that floor. It is also possible to utilize the system for BGM (Background Music) as each zone is able to have its own music source and volume levels or the same source can be routed to specific zones, a group of zones or all zones). White noise too, can be integrated with the system.
